Higher analytic stacks and GAGA theorems
Published 16 Dec 2014 in math.AG | (1412.5166v2)
Abstract: We develop the foundations of higher geometric stacks in complex analytic geometry and in non-archimedean analytic geometry. We study coherent sheaves and prove the analog of Grauert's theorem for derived direct images under proper morphisms. We define analytification functors and prove the analog of Serre's GAGA theorems for higher stacks. We use the language of infinity category to simplify the theory. In particular, it enables us to circumvent the functoriality problem of the lisse-\'etale sites for sheaves on stacks. Our constructions and theorems cover the classical 1-stacks as a special case.
